diff --git a/src/browser/main/tab/page/mod.rs b/src/browser/main/tab/page/mod.rs index a5a407df..2030e93d 100644 --- a/src/browser/main/tab/page/mod.rs +++ b/src/browser/main/tab/page/mod.rs @@ -72,9 +72,11 @@ impl Page { } } else { // Plain text given, make search request to default provider - Uri::escape_string(&request_text, None, false); self.navigation.set_request_text( - &GString::from(format!("gemini://tlgs.one/search?{request_text}")), + &GString::from(format!( + "gemini://tlgs.one/search?{}", + Uri::escape_string(&request_text, None, false) + )), true, // activate (page reload) ); }